inserted SSD but inactive

MacBookPro 15” A1226 2.2 GHz - I followed the lead of Walter Galan using a Crucial MX500 2.5 SSD (1 TB), but the MacBook does not see it. Why ?. Do I need to use a specific SSD? Thanks - Email: giorgio_rossetti@hotmail.com

Sad to tell you need a different SSD! The SATA I/O of your system is only SATA I (1.5 Gb/s) Most drives today are a fixed speed SATA III (6.0 Gb/s). One of the few drives you can get that will work in your system is a Samsung 860 EVO. Look at the Interface line in the space sheet you’ll see it supports 1.5 Gb/s. What ever drive you get needs to list it like this one.

Now the bad news! Keep in mind this system is unable to support newer more secure OS-X versions and the one you needed that properly supports SSD’s. You need OS-X Yosemite 10.10.x  or newer. I’m not sure if its worth the cost. I would just stick with a cheaper HDD drive (again one that runs at SATA I speed). I also wouldn’t use it online or store any personal info on it either if you are using anything older than OS-X El Capitan 10.11.x.
